The pain went straight to her heart Excluded from her father's will, Laura was banished from her home by her cold unfeeling stepmother. Fate offered a solution in the form of Blaise Hunter, but he accepted her as his young daughter's governess. The dynamic boss of the cattle station doubted Laura, a fragile beauty, could cope with the harsh outback. Laura, too, had doubts. Not of the land but of the man, who, instinct warned her, could cause her far greater suffering.
